Verdict

SCOTCHTOWN ran well on his latest start at Newbury and should appreciate the drop in grade so gets the nod. A first win over fences at Fakenham clearly boosted the confidence of Sideways as he followed up over this trip at Sedgefield, though has been raised a further 7lb. Firebird Flyer won the Midland National in 2016 but he’s not the same force nowadays, though much lower in the handicap. Alberto's Dream will have needed his comeback run at Hereford and Sandhurst Lad and Court Frontier are others to consider. Big Meadow is now 4lb lower than for his last success but has disappointed the last twice.
